On March 5, commencing at 4:00 p.m. for approximately 30 minutes, Ms. TAKAICHI Sanae, Prime Minister of Japan, received a courtesy call from H.E. Dr. Sultan Al Jaber, Minister of Industry and Advanced Technology and Special Envoy of the United Arab Emirates (UAE) to Japan, who is visiting Japan. The overview is as follows:

  1. At the outset, Prime Minister TAKAICHI expressed her concern over the recent deterioration of the situation surrounding Iran, and stated that Japan condemns attacks by Iran against civilian facilities and other targets. Prime Minister TAKAICHI also requested the UAE’s cooperation in ensuring the safety of Japanese nationals and the stable supply of oil to Japan. In response, Minister Jaber expressed the UAE’s intention to cooperate in ensuring the safety of Japanese nationals and stable supply of oil.
  2. Both sides welcomed the conclusion of the negotiations for Japan-UAE Comprehensive Economic Partnership Agreement (CEPA), for which negotiations had been launched between the two countries in September 2024. They also concurred to continue cooperating towards the signing of this agreement between the two countries.
  3. Prime Minister TAKAICHI also expressed her hope to further strengthening cooperation in various fields with the UAE, who is a comprehensive strategic partner of Japan. In response, Minister Jaber expressed his renewed hope for strengthening bilateral relations with Japan.
